Abstract(in English) | As a solution to the binding problem, there is a hypothesis that the binding of information is represented by phase-locking among oscillatory recognition cells. We conducted a basic study to implement this hypothesis into a neural model of separated extraction of information by two self-organizing neural fields. We showed that a neural oscillator field with two Mexican-hat connection patterns keeps two or more than two localized oscillatory excitations stably around local maximums of external inputs, and also realizes in-phase phase-locking within a localized oscillatory excitation, but anti-phase phase-locking between different localized oscillatory excitations. |
